Sunday MLB Opening Odds
(The Spread) – Can the Red Sox and Twins shake out of their recent funks? Can the Pirates stay hot? Check out opening MLB lines for Sunday’s action.
The Boston Red Sox have lost four in a row and are now looking to avoid being swept by the Pittsburgh Pirates, who have won four-straight. The two teams will square off for Game 3 of their series at 1:35PM ET.
According to oddsmakers from online sports book Bodog, the visiting Red Sox are –125 on the money line against the host Pirates, who are +115 on the ML. As previously mentioned, Pittsburgh is 4-0 in its last four games overall and 4-0 in its last four home games.
Another struggling team will try to snap a four-game skid when the Twins play the Brewers in Milwaukee to wrap up a three-game series. Carl Pavano will take the hill against Chris Narveson, who is 4-5 on the year with a 4.55 ERA.
The ESPN Sunday Night Baseball Game features the defending champs taking on the surprising Cleveland Indians at 8:05PM ET. The Giants opened as –135 money line favorites over the Tribe, who are +125 on the ML.
According to recent MLB trends, the Indians are 1-4 in their last five games against the Giants, while the under is 5-0-1 in the last six meetings between these two teams. Despite scoring just five runs in the first two games, the G-Men will go for the series sweep on Sunday night.
